Job Title :  JIS Clinical Case Manager

Program :  JIS - Justice Involved Services

location :  Office 1191 Lakewood Road, Toms River New Jersey

Position Type :  Full Time

Salary :  $40,000.00

Bonus :  $2,000.00 paid in 4 quarterly installments.  First after 90 days.

Job Description / Summary

The "JIS Clinical Case Manager" is responsible for providing community-based outreach to link or re-link consumers to services needed. Assists consumers that would otherwise enter the criminal justice system with advocacy and education of the legal system.

Responsibilities

  • Individual needs of persons served are addressed including assessment and evaluation, referral, follow-up services, individual, group, and family therapy.
  • Works effectively with the full spectrum of diagnosis disorders.
  • Meet weekly productivity targets.
  • One late day / early day required.
  • On call phone coverage rotation.

Competencies

  • Proficiently communicates - written and verbal
  • Demonstrates empathy and compassion
  • Able to work independently effectively manage schedule
  • Qualifications

  • Education BA in Social Work, Psychology, Counseling, or related field or AA in a related field.
  • Experience Two years’ experience working with individuals with mental illness. Criminal Justice experience preferred.
  • License - Valid NJ Driver's License in good standing
